Transaction 58a31b4843311d50589137dba227af9d92e907600375575d3307240729a97e42

1 Input
2 Outputs
  • 58a31b4843311d50589137dba227af9d92e907600375575d3307240729a97e42:0
  • value  1211678
    address  378f5qErdACLS2i8pTSne3AKhuDMi45UXn
  • 58a31b4843311d50589137dba227af9d92e907600375575d3307240729a97e42:1
  • value  39196279
    address  3LhqzgLELJVLDkbuVdktTvkaXo11M2Y446